text: Arul Vivasvan Suppiah is a former Malaysian cricketer. As a right-handed batsman and left-arm orthodox spin bowler, he played for the Malaysia national cricket team and county cricket in England for Somerset County Cricket Club. His career highs involve holding a world record for best Twenty20 bowling figures and first-class innings of 156 against India, in a match before the Test series against England.
